This page documents the development of my educational VPS server, a centralised platform built to support teaching, learning, and digital collaboration. At the core of the system is Moodle, enhanced with tools like completion tracking, Level Up, CodeRunner, and VPL to improve engagement and support programming education. Alongside it, WordPress is used to showcase student portfolios, podcasts, and surveys, while MediaCMS provides an internal YouTube-style platform for sharing video content. Gitea serves as a space for managing code repositories, and Metabase helps analyse data and gain insights into platform usage and learning progress. All of these tools are connected through a unified login system, allowing users to access everything they need in one place. This page is where I share updates, challenges, and ideas as the platform continues to evolve.
Building My Educational VPS Platform






